Arteta Set To Leave Arsenal

Arteta seems closer to a transfer to Italy rather than to a new deal with Arsenal. Apparently, Fiorentina are interested in signing the 32 year old midfielder who simply cannot reach an agreement with this current club. The Spaniard has become a primary target for the Italians who lost three of their most important players. Their offer might be tempting considering the Gunners’ policy regarding players over 30. Artenta will not receive a contract which exceeds 1 year in length. Because of that he might be looking to find something closer to a long-term commitment.

The 32 year old seemed a bit bothered by the club’s policy. The Spaniard pointed out that age is not as important and that he has different values than Arsenal when it comes to such concepts. According to the Daily Mail, He also pointed out the fact that despite being one of the oldest players in Wenger’s lot he still managed to make more appearances than younger colleagues who barely made it to half of his stats.


Moving to Fiorentina would be a step back for Arteta. The Italians will not play in the Champions League next year but will be features in the Europa League. With Arsenal looking to increase their squad and spend big money on important transfers, Arteta might have a shot at actually winning the competition next year. Unfortunately things are not going well between him and the club. The player seems unhappy with the fact that he is not being offered a long-term deal which means a transfer is very likely.
